Ditto to what others have said on the Kenwood paired with the Idatalink maestro unit. You can maintain all stock sync / steering wheel controls functions, you can even reprogram steering wheel controls to perform different functions if you want. Haven't posted my pics yet but I have just finished installing a Kenwood DNX691 with the maestro RR unit and absolutely love it.
